> Samba 3.5.7, 3.4.12 and 3.3.15 are security releases in order to
> address CVE-2011-0719.
>
> o CVE-2011-0719:
> All current released versions of Samba are vulnerable to
> a denial of service caused by memory corruption. Range
> checks on file descriptors being used in the FD_SET macro
> were not present allowing stack corruption. This can cause
> the Samba code to crash or to loop attempting to select
> on a bad file descriptor set.
